Capitalism, Ethics, and Social Responsibility
This chapter explores the decisions of tech industry leaders and their impact on corporate ethics and social responsibility. It discusses the potential of strategic investments, including buying gun manufacturers and influencing environmental practices, as a means for activists to drive systemic change. The conversation highlights the evolving relationship between capitalism and social activism, emphasizing the power of financial incentives over philanthropic efforts in shaping public policy.
